jqPlot - 如何在y轴上显示文本?

时间:2012-05-02 05:28:33

标签: jqplot

我有一个数组,其中包含x轴的日期和我的y轴的1-3之间的整数值,如下所示:

chartData = [["19-Jan-2012",1],["20-Jan-2012",2],["21-Jan-2012",1],["22-Jan-2012",3]];

问题1: 我希望看到文本而不是1和2和3,如下所示:  “高”而不是3,   “中”而不是2,  “低”而不是1。

怎么做?

问题2:

如何永久显示每个点旁边的标签,而不仅仅是用荧光笔显示鼠标?

1 个答案:

答案 0 :(得分:0)

您可以使用第三个参数,例如[[1,4,'mid'], [3 5,'hi'], [7,2,'low']],并在选项字符串

中使用此参数
series:[{
  pointLabels:{
    labels:['mid', 'hi', 'low'],
    location:'se',
    ypadding: 12
  }
}]

试试这个我想你想要的是http://www.jqplot.com/tests/point-labels.php 但是你仍然必须用x系列将数值传递给数据。

在上面的链接中,您可以找到我猜的确切解决方案..

干杯..